Are You a Central Texas Musician?

  • Austin Texas Musicians is for you! We are musicians working for musicians.

  • Our community of Central Texas musicians is over 6,000 strong and growing.

  • We represent those we serve on city, state, and federal policy and provide basic needs and services to improve our quality of life.

  • Advocacy, Education, and Economic Development are the three pillars of our work to empower you to “Show Up, Speak Up, and Be Heard"!
